What does a material control associate do?

A Material Control Associate is responsible for managing the flow of materials and inventory within a warehouse or manufacturing facility. Their duties include receiving, storing, and issuing materials, maintaining accurate inventory records, and coordinating with other departments to ensure timely supply of materials for production. They also help with cycle counts, tracking shipments, and resolving discrepancies in inventory. This role is essential for preventing production delays and ensuring efficient operations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a material control associate?

To thrive as a Material Control Associate, you need a solid understanding of inventory management, supply chain processes, and basic logistics, typically sup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with warehouse management systems (WMS), barcode scanners, and inventory tracking software is typically required. Attention to detail, organizational skills, and effective communication help ensure accuracy and coordination within teams. These skills and qualities are crucial for maintaining efficient material flow, minimizing errors, and supporting overall operational productivity.

How does a material control associate typically interact with other departments within a manufacturing facility?

Material Control Associates play a crucial role in ensuring the smooth flow of materials throughout the production process. They regularly collaborate with purchasing, production, and warehouse teams to track inventory levels, resolve shortages, and coordinate timely deliveries. Effective communication is essential as they must relay material status updates, address discrepancies, and help maintain production schedules. This cross-departmental coordination helps minimize downtime and supports efficient manufacturing operations.

What is the difference between Material Control Associate vs Inventory Clerk?

AspectMaterial Control AssociateInventory Clerk
CredentialsHigh school diploma; certifications in inventory management or logisticsHigh school diploma; familiarity with inventory software
Work EnvironmentManufacturing, warehouse, or production facilitiesWarehouses, retail stores, or distribution centers
Employer & Industry UsageManufacturing companies, aerospace, automotiveRetail, logistics, warehousing
Common Search & ComparisonMaterial Control Associate vs Inventory Clerk

The Material Control Associate and Inventory Clerk roles both involve managing stock and supplies, often within warehouse or manufacturing settings. While they share similar credentials and work environments, Material Control Associates typically focus more on controlling material flow and ensuring proper inventory levels in production environments, whereas Inventory Clerks often handle stock counts and record-keeping in retail or distribution centers. Understanding these differences can help job seekers identify the best fit for their skills and career goals.
